Table 2. Estimates of metabolic rate over time (mg O2/h) from self-starting nonlinear asymptotic regression model for all species.
| Species | Dwelling | R 0 | Asym | k | ||||||
| Mean±SE | t | P | Mean±SE | t | P | Mean±SE | t | P | ||
| In the regression model, R0 represents initial value of the dependent variable at time zero, Asym is the asymptotic value, and k is the rate constant. | ||||||||||
| T. longibarbata | Cave | 0.175±0.012 | 14.467 | <0.001 | 0.067±0.003 | 22.274 | <0.001 | 1.224±0.250 | 4.853 | <0.001 |
| T. jiarongensis | Cave | 0.097±0.007 | 14.139 | <0.001 | 0.039±0.003 | 13.448 | <0.001 | 0.560±0.158 | 3.539 | 0.001 |
| T. rosa | Cave | 0.314±0.015 | 21.240 | <0.001 | 0.131±0.005 | 28.900 | <0.001 | 0.659±0.072 | 9.160 | <0.001 |
| T. nasobarbatula | River | 0.584±0.019 | 30.427 | <0.001 | 0.105±0.003 | 32.434 | <0.001 | 7.100±1.215 | 5.845 | <0.001 |
| T. dongsaiensis | River | 0.349±0.003 | 102.340 | <0.001 | 0.057±0.001 | 97.500 | <0.001 | 5.783±0.252 | 22.910 | <0.001 |
| T. bleekeri | River | 0.796±0.029 | 27.580 | <0.001 | 0.170±0.006 | 29.810 | <0.001 | 1.591±0.141 | 11.290 | <0.001 |
